Tipo di azione personalizzato 53
Questa azione personalizzata viene scritta in JScript, ad esempio ECMA 262. Windows Installer non supporta JScript 1.0. Per altre informazioni, vedere script .
Fonte
Il campo Origine della tabella CustomAction contiene un nome di proprietà o una chiave per la tabella Proprietà per una proprietà contenente il testo dello script.
Valore del tipo
Includere il valore seguente nella colonna Tipo della tabella CustomAction per specificare il tipo numerico di base di un'azione personalizzata a 32 bit.
Costanti | Esadecimale | Decimale |
---|---|---|
msidbCustomActionTypeJScript + msidbCustomActionTypeProperty | 0x035 | 53 |
Windows Installer può usare azioni personalizzate a 64 bit nei sistemi operativi a 64 bit. Un'azione personalizzata a 64 bit basata su script deve includere il msidbCustomActionType64BitScript bit nel tipo numerico. Per informazioni, vedere azioni personalizzate a 64 bit. Includere il valore seguente nella colonna Tipo della tabella CustomAction per specificare il tipo numerico di base di un'azione personalizzata a 64 bit.
Costanti | Esadecimale | Decimale |
---|---|---|
msidbCustomActionTypeJScript + msidbCustomActionTypeProperty + msidbCustomActionType64BitScript | 0x0001035 | 4149 |
Bersaglio
Il campo Destinazione della tabella CustomAction contiene una funzione script facoltativa. L'elaborazione invia prima lo script per l'analisi e quindi chiama la funzione script facoltativa.
Opzioni di elaborazione restituite
Includere i bit di flag facoltativi nella colonna Tipo della tabella CustomAction per specificare le opzioni di elaborazione restituite. Per una descrizione delle opzioni e dei valori, vedere Opzioni di elaborazione restituite azioni personalizzate.
Opzioni di pianificazione dell'esecuzione
Includere i bit di flag facoltativi nella colonna Tipo della tabella CustomAction per specificare le opzioni di pianificazione dell'esecuzione. Queste opzioni controllano l'esecuzione multipla di azioni personalizzate. Per una descrizione delle opzioni, vedere opzioni di pianificazione dell'esecuzione di azioni personalizzate.
Opzioni di esecuzione di In-Script
Includere bit di flag facoltativi nella colonna Tipo della tabella CustomAction per specificare un'opzione di esecuzione in-script. Queste opzioni copiano il codice azione nello script di esecuzione, rollback o commit. Per una descrizione delle opzioni, vedere Opzioni di esecuzione In-Script azioni personalizzate.
Valori restituiti
Le funzioni facoltative scritte nello script devono restituire uno dei valori descritti in valori restituiti di azioni personalizzate JScript e VBScript.
Osservazioni
Un'azione personalizzata scritta in JScript richiede l'installazione 'oggetto Session. Poiché l'oggetto sessione di potrebbe non esistere durante un rollback dell'installazione, un'azione personalizzata posticipata scritta nello script usa uno dei metodi descritti in Ottenere informazioni di contesto per azioni personalizzate di esecuzione posticipata.
Argomenti correlati